About P1133

P1133 is a manufacturer-specific powertrain diagnostic trouble code recorded for Isuzu vehicles. It belongs to the P-prefix family of codes, which covers engine, transmission, emissions, or fuel-system faults.

When P1133 is stored, the module has detected a bank-specific fault, meaning it applies only to one cylinder bank of a multi-bank engine; and a sensor-related fault — the reported value from the named sensor is out of spec.

Scanning & clearing: A generic OBD-II scan tool will usually read and clear powertrain (P) codes. For live data, freeze-frame capture, and bi-directional tests you may need a more capable scan tool that supports the vehicle's ECM protocol.

P1133 is a manufacturer-specific code. The same code string on a different make may have a different meaning. Always confirm the code's definition against the vehicle's service information for the specific make and model under test.

Code Information

The heated oxygen sensor (H02S) on Bank 1 Sensor 1 sits upstream of the catalytic converter and switches its output voltage as the air fuel mixture crosses stoichiometric, allowing the ECM to maintain closed loop fuel control. DTC P1133 sets when the ECM determines the upstream sensor is not switching between rich and lean often enough, indicating a slow or lazy sensor response. A healthy zirconia sensor should cross between roughly 0.1 volt lean and 0.9 volt rich several times per second once warm.
